Thanksgiving Stuffing Topped Hummus

This Thanksgiving stuffing topped hummus takes all the flavors of traditional stuffing and places them right on top of hummus. It's so easy to make and full of flavor. Your whole family will love it!

Ingredients

  • 10 ounces plain hummus
  • 1/3 pound spicy Italian sausage removed from casing
  • 1 stalk celery small dice
  • 1 small shallot small dice
  • 1/2 tart apple small dice
  • 1/4 cup dried cranberries roughly chopped
  • 1 teaspoon minced fresh sage
  • 1 teaspoon minced fresh rosemary
  • 1 teaspoon fresh thyme leaves
  • ½ teaspoon kosher salt
  • ¼ teaspoon ground black pepper

Instructions

  • Spread hummus out onto a platter leaving a space in the middle of the hummus to be topped, set aside. 
  • In a 12-inch frying pan add sausage and set over medium-high heat. 
  • Break up the sausage while cooking. When the sausage is almost done add in the celery, shallot, apple, dried cranberries, sage, rosemary, and thyme. 
  • Continue cooking until the sausage is no longer pink and the vegetables have just started to soften. 
  • Taste and season with kosher salt and black pepper. 
  • Top the hummus with the warm sausage mixture. 
  • Serve with toasted bread.
